A refrigerator includes an automatic filing water storage system. The refrigerator includes a cabinet having a fresh-food compartment and a door pivotally mounted to the cabinet. The system includes a dispenser positioned in the fresh-food compartment and a docking base positioned in one of the fresh-food compartment and the door. A container is configured to be supported by the docking base. In a docked position and when the door is in a closed position, the dispenser is configured to selectively dispense liquid into the container based upon a sensed fill level condition. When the door is in an open position, the dispenser is configured to dispense liquid based upon engagement of an actuator by a user.

A heat recovery variable-frequency multi-split heat pump system and a control method thereof. The system includes an outdoor unit and at least two indoor units. The system is a three-pipe heating recovery multi-split heat pump system designed on the basis of a four-way reversing valve, and one indoor unit thereof is provided with two electronic expansion valves and two heat exchangers so that any indoor unit in the system can operate independently under three working conditions of refrigeration, heating or heat recovery dehumidification. Under multi-split condition, the system can operate under six working conditions, namely, the full-refrigeration working condition, the full-heating working condition, the common-heat-recovery working condition, the common-heat-recovery-dehumidification working condition, the heat recovery dehumidification-refrigeration-combination working condition and the heat recovery dehumidification-heating-combination working condition. Under the heat recovery dehumidification condition, a lower outlet air temperature, during low-temperature dehumidification, is raised by means of heat removal of a condenser so as to achieve the purpose of dehumidification without temperature fall or temperature rise, so that the thermal comfort and efficiency of the system are improved, and the refrigerating capacity and heating capacity of the system are effectively improved.

A device for converting wavelength and a projection light source are disclosed in the present disclosure. According to an example, the device may comprise a roller, a drive motor, a first reflector, a support shaft, a drive module and a dichroic film. An axis of the support shaft may be coincided with an axis of the roller. The support shaft may be not rotated with rotation of the roller. The drive motor may drive the roller rotate around the support shaft and the drive module may drive the roller to move back and forth along an axial direction of the support shaft. So excitation light reflected by the first reflector may be incident uniformly on the sidewall of the roller. Therefore, fluorescent powder conversion efficiency may be improved compared with that of the excitation light incident on a fixed area.
